¿Qué es Ciudadanía Americana?

US citizenship through naturalization grants foreign nationals full legal rights and responsibilities as American citizens. The process requires meeting specific eligibility criteria, including lawful permanent resident status, continuous residence in the United States, physical presence requirements, and good moral character. Applicants must demonstrate English language proficiency and knowledge of U.S. civics and history. The naturalization process in California involves filing Form N-400 with U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services, attending biometric appointments, passing interviews, and taking the Oath of Allegiance. Upon approval, you receive a Certificate of Naturalization, enabling you to vote, obtain a U.S. passport, and sponsor family members. The entire process typically takes 8-12 months, though timelines vary.

💰 ¿Cuánto cuesta?

US citizenship naturalization requires USCIS filing fees around $640, plus biometric services fees. Attorney representation typically costs $2,500 or more, depending on complexity and local market rates. Some nonprofits in Yuba County offer reduced-cost services. Preguntas Frecuentes

Q: How long must I live in Yuba County?

A: Generally, you need five years as a permanent resident, or three years if married to a U.S. citizen. You must physically be in the U.S. for at least half that time.
